Featured dishes

View full menu
Moo-Goo Gai Pan
Sliced white meat chicken stir-fried with mushrooms, snow peas, carrots, and broccoli in a light white sauce.
Kong Pao Chicken
Hot and spicy.
Chicken Cashew Nuts
Chicken stir-fried with cashew nuts, carrots, celery, and water chestnuts, typically includes mushrooms in a savory brown sauce.
Almond Chicken
Diced chicken stir-fried with vegetables, typically includes mushrooms and water chestnuts, enveloped in a savory brown sauce and generously topped with sliced almonds.
Chicken Chow Mein
Stir-fried chicken with celery, onions, and bean sprouts, typically includes crispy noodles.

John RusscherJohn Russcher
My recent experiences with this restaurant have left me disappointed, and I am hesitant to order from here again. I've utilized Grubhub delivery three times, ordering an entrée and hot sour soup each time. Unfortunately, my dissatisfaction stems from inconsistencies in the orders. On the first two occasions, the hot sour soup was replaced with a different entrée, leading to a sense of frustration. Although my latest order did include the hot sour soup, it deviated significantly from my expectations. Rather than the familiar texture of hot and sour soup, it resembled more of an egg drop soup with unexpected additions such as mushrooms, carrots, and an unfamiliar meat. Regrettably, the flavor profile did not align with any traditional hot and sour or egg drop soup I have experienced, and I found it to be unappealing. Additionally, I ordered the Hot & Spiced Szechuan Chicken Combo Plate with chicken fried rice. The chicken fried rice was disappointing, featuring large, tasteless pieces of chicken that did not enhance the overall dish. Furthermore, the Hot & Spiced Szechuan Chicken failed to live up to its name—it lacked the promised heat and spiciness, and the overall taste was underwhelming.
Austin BeattieAustin Beattie
Portion sizes are on the smaller side, which is good because you probably won’t want to eat everything. Sarcasm aside, my last few orders have been small (I’m not too demanding but a $13 combo plate should have more than 6 pieces of chicken), the fried rice isn’t cooked to order, and despite the food usually being hot and fast; it somehow tastes stale. The strip mall in which it resides is also filled with sketchy vape stores and a lot overwhelmed with pot holes. Hoping things improve as this place is dear, as well as convenient! China Inn South has long been a pillar of Holland’s Chinese scene. My folks used to take me to the old one on 32nd for many fondly remembered meals. Hoping things improve because we sincerely do enjoy this restaurant.
